Google AI Studio (Gemini API)
Access to Google's Gemini models through AI Studio API for text generation, image generation (Nano Banana Pro), embeddings, and multimodal AI capabilities.

Authentication
Unlike other Google services, AI Studio uses a simple API key (not OAuth2).
Setup
- •Go to Google AI Studio
- •Click "Get API key" or go to API keys section
- •Create a new API key
- •Add to
.env:
GEMINI_API_KEY="your-api-key-here"

Available Models
Text Generation
- •
gemini-2.0-flash- Fast, efficient (default) - •
gemini-2.0-flash-lite- Fastest, most cost-effective - •
gemini-2.5-pro-preview-05-06- Most capable reasoning - •
gemini-2.5-flash-preview-05-20- Fast with enhanced capabilities
Image Generation
- •
nano-banana-pro/nbp→gemini-3-pro-image-preview(default, best quality) - •
nano-banana/nb→gemini-2.5-flash-image(faster, 500 images/day free tier)
Embeddings
- •
text-embedding-004- Latest embedding model (default)

Rate Limits
Text Generation (Free Tier):
| Model | RPM | RPD |
|---|---|---|
| gemini-2.0-flash | 15 | 1,500 |
| gemini-2.5-pro | 5 | 50 |
Image Generation (Free Tier):
| Model | IPM | IPD |
|---|---|---|
| gemini-3-pro-image-preview | 2 | 100-500 |
| gemini-2.5-flash-image | 2 | 500 |
RPM = Requests/min, RPD = Requests/day, IPM = Images/min, IPD = Images/day
Paid Tier: $0.02-0.04 per image for higher limits.
